If so, then we have the role for you!Poised for further growth, and investment, we are now seeking to recruit a Junior Production Planner who will help deliver fantastic service in a fast paced manufacturing facility. The successful Junior Production Planner will be responsible for checking the production plan is met, liaising with internal production, quality, purchasing and logistics teams (and external suppliers and customers) to make sure parts are in the right place at the right time for prouction volumes to be hit.Junior Production Planner - Role and Responsibilities - ERP / MRP / Production Planning / Production Control / Supply Chain* Delivering against Production Plans and Work Orders that meet customer requirements and are in line with production capacity* Liaising cross functionally with all areas of Operations as required to maintain an accurate Production Plan* Action customer Defer & Expedite requests, where possible* Proactively liaising directly with the Sales, Service, Manufacturing, Purchasing and Supply Chain teams to feedback any changes to the Production Plan that may impact customer delivery* Learning about ERP systemsJunior Production Planner - Skills and Abilities - ERP / MRP / Production Planning / Production Control / Supply Chain* GCSE or equivalent in English and Maths at a good standard* Any Production Planning / Scheduling experience within a manufacturing environment would be beneficial* Previous experience preparing production plans against capacity hours, understanding Work Orders, as well as exporting and analysing data would give a distinct advantage* An understanding of planning process requirementsJunior Production Planner, ERP, MRP, Production Planning, Production Control, Supply ChainIf this role could appeal please do apply now!
